Hawaii concealed carry restrictions ruled unconstitutional
The 2nd opinion is Wolford. The court holds Hawaii’s law barring licensed concealed-carry permit holders from carrying handguns on private property open to the public without the property owner’s express authorization violates the 2nd and 14th Amendmentshttps://t.co/KVe3PlUahe
